Dear Mr Clark & Mr Whitehouse,

RANGERS FC

I am writing in relation to the current situation of Rangers FC.

I am MSP for Mid-Scotland & Fife and also Convenor of the Scottish Parliament’s Economy,

Energy and Tourism Committee, although I am writing this in a personal capacity. I am also

a debenture holder at Rangers FC and therefore technically a creditor of the company.

I know that as administrators you are currently considering bids for the company. I believe

that it is essential that any bidder considering liquidation is ruled out of the process. I say

this for two reasons – firstly, liquidation would deprive HMRC of funds properly due to the

taxpayer and, secondly, liquidation would jeopardise the future existence of an institution

which means so much to so many people across the world.

It is in the interests of HMRC that Rangers FC exit administration through a Company

Voluntary Arrangement and therefore I believe that only bids that offer this course of action

should be taken forward by the administrators.

You will welcome the support from the fans of the Club, including the three supporters’

groups coming together to raise funds and who have now made payments to Dunfermline FC

on behalf of the club. If Rangers FC is liquidated and a new club is established I fear that

some of this support may disappear, which will damage the Club’s revival.

It is a fact that Scottish football needs to change and adapt. It is in the interests for Scottish

division will help bring in revenue. The long-term economic interests of Scottish football

and Rangers FC are best served if the club is not liquidated.

The administrators have a unique opportunity to see a new form of ownership for Rangers

FC, where the fan is at the heart of the club, and this can be a catalyst to help improve

Scottish football.
